Finance in Savannah, GA Overview
Savannah, Georgia (pop. 147,780) has 12 colleges offering Finance programs. The local cost of living index of 95 is near the national average, with average rent near campus at $1,169/month. Finance enrollment is stable nationwide, with steady demand for graduates skilled in Financial Modeling and Valuation. The adjusted starting salary in Savannah is approximately $66,500, growing to $104,500 by mid-career.

Methodology & Education Data Sources
How we calculate Finance degree outcomes in Savannah, GA: Our salary projections, ROI estimates, and tuition data combine multiple federal datasets to provide a localized view of education economics. We use a 10-year career-trajectory model standard in higher education research.
- Tuition data sourced from IPEDS (Integrated Postsecondary Education Data System), the federal education statistics database operated by NCES. Average tuition for Finance programs reflects 4-year public/private weighted averages for Georgia.
- Career salary projections based on BLS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ics, with cost-of-living adjustments for Savannah using regional CPI data.
- 10-year ROI calculates: (Total Career Earnings With Degree) − (Total Career Earnings Without Degree) − (Total Education Cost Including Interest on Loans).
- Job market outlook for Finance graduates uses BLS Occupational Outlook Handbook 10-year projections (2024-2034 base period).
- Default rates and loan data sourced from College Scorecard (US Department of Education), which tracks repayment outcomes by institution.
